revenge
It was dusk when Qin Lan'er was awakened by her wet nurse.
"The young master is back..." The nurse's voice trembled a little.
Qin Lan'er rubbed her sleepy eyes and went over her nanny's words in her dull mind.
What! Brother is back!
Qin Lan'er woke up instantly, quickly put on her clothes, and followed her nanny to see her brother.
Along the way, Qin Lan'er wondered why her brother came home so late at night. Was he trying to persuade her to give up this marriage again? Humph, forget it! Ziyu treated me so well. I'll never find another person as good as him.
If all else fails, I'll threaten you with death. Brother, you love me the most, so you'll definitely agree to me.
The joy of reunion after a long separation was intertwined with concerns and doubts, forming a cage that was difficult to escape. The cage was ultimately an illusion, and when she saw her brother, the cage collapsed.
She took three steps at a time and rushed to her brother. The familiar eyes and eyebrows in front of her were stained with bright red blood. The clothes and the floor were all covered with bright red color, which stung her eyes and hurt her heart even more.
She knelt down and held her brother's cold hand with her trembling hand.
The dying, blood-soaked man in front of her was her brother...
The nanny wiped her red eyes.
Her brother moved his lips, and she put her ear close to his lips.
My brother said intermittently: "It was... Liu Ziyu who killed me... to avenge me..."
She bit her lower lip tightly, forcing herself not to cry out: "Brother... Brother, see a doctor first, wait until your injury is healed, then..."
My brother has no voice, no heartbeat...
The nurse hugged her, stroking her back over and over again, and whispered, "The young master is the head of the family. No one must know that the young master has passed away."
She understood that she was more awake now than ever before.
She bit her sleeve and whimpered softly...
She placed her brother's body in an ice coffin and started a plan called "revenge."
She sharpened the silver needle every day, practicing the uncanny skill of inserting the needle deep into the dead acupoint.
She often stroked the jade pendant that her brother held tightly in his hand before he died. It was Liu Ziyu's jade pendant.
She occasionally mentioned her brother in front of Liu Ziyu on purpose, to see his unnatural expression and his evasive gaze.
God rewards those who work hard. Finally, she went to look for Liu Ziyu and happened to see that Liu Ziyu was accidentally injured by a fellow disciple. The sword wound was on the side of his heart, but he was not dead. The attacker fled in panic.
She walked over, looked at his hopeful expression, and caressed his face lovingly and tenderly. With her other hand, she fiercely inserted the silver needle into his vital point, watching his shocked and desperate expression and his near-death struggle.
In a moment, everything returned to calm.
The calmness emptied her heart.
At this moment, she cried.
The crying sound echoed in the dead silent forest, strange and terrifying.
